Abstract

With seemingly no end to the global pandemic in sight, high expectations are growing for the development of medicines to treat COVID-19, in addition to the vaccination which has been carried out recently. In Japan also, development of such medicines is accelerating and now four COVID-19 medicines have been approved.There is, however, concern that the COVID-19 medicines are not always effective, so that, in the present paper, we investigate the consequence of incomplete treatment of COVID-19-infected patients by constructing a simple intertemporal theoretical model. Main result we obtained is that incomplete treatment of infected patients increases number of the infected people, which is equivalent to say “worse than nothing”.
